Frequently Asked Questions about Westbrooke

What type of rentals are currently available in Westbrooke?

There are currently 89 Apartments for Rent in Westbrooke, KS with pricing that ranges from $845 to $10,649. There are also 25 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Westbrooke ranging from $795 to $4,000.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Westbrooke?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Westbrooke ranges from $795 to $4,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,837.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Westbrooke?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Westbrooke range from $1,365 to $10,649,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,700 to $4,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,649 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,510.
